Overview

Quotes Logo The Full-Day Port Arthur Historic Site Tour and Admission Ticket invites visitors to step back in time and explore the haunting beauty of the UNESCO World Heritage-listed Port Arthur Historic Site. This tour offers nearly seven hours to independently discover the depths of this significant landmark, a former convict settlement steeped in compelling history. The Port Arthur Historic Site is not just a place; it's an immersive experience that brings Australia's colonial past to life.

Visitors can explore the infamous penitentiary, wander through the well-preserved gardens, and imagine the lives of convicts and free settlers who once resided within its walls. The included site entry ticket grants access to a guided introductory walking tour, setting the stage for a deeper understanding of the site's layered history. A relaxing harbour cruise is also included, offering unique perspectives of the historic buildings from the water.

This full-day experience provides round-trip transport in an air-conditioned vehicle, ensuring a comfortable journey to and from this unforgettable destination. Please note that lunch is not included, allowing guests the flexibility to dine at their leisure within the site's cafes or picnic areas. Quotes Logo

Port Arthur Historic Site

Step back in time at the Port Arthur Historic Site,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and Australia's most intact convict settlement. Immerse yourself in the poignant history of this 19th-century penal colony through a guided walking tour that brings to life the stories of convicts and their custodians. A 25-minute harbor cruise offers a unique perspective of the site's stunning coastal setting and allows you to contemplate the isolation experienced by those once imprisoned here. Explore over 30 historic buildings, from the imposing Penitentiary to the serene church, wander through meticulously restored houses and heritage gardens, and reflect on the haunting past that shaped this significant landmark. Port Arthur is not just a historic site; it's a deeply moving experience that connects you to Australia's convict heritage.
